amd-iommu: implement suspend/resume
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This patch puts everything together and enables suspend/resume support
in the AMD IOMMU driver.

static int amd_iommu_resume(struct sys_device *dev)
{
/*
* Disable IOMMUs before reprogramming the hardware registers.
* IOMMU is still enabled from the resume kernel.
*/
disable_iommus();

/* re-load the hardware */
enable_iommus();

/*
* we have to flush after the IOMMUs are enabled because a
* disabled IOMMU will never execute the commands we send
*/
amd_iommu_flush_all_domains();
amd_iommu_flush_all_devices();

return 0;
}

static int amd_iommu_suspend(struct sys_device *dev, pm_message_t state)
{
return -EINVAL;
/* disable IOMMUs to go out of the way for BIOS */
disable_iommus();

return 0;
}
